Output 58e380e8470e54d31e9d494c5d560def13f4918f8b1d69a18f85ef29469d773b:1

value
254082
script pubkey
OP_0 OP_PUSHBYTES_20 3d525753c428ddfc1892aea49e5531f69058bb6b
address
bc1q84f9w57y9rwlcxyj46jfu4f376g93wmty0yrnf
transaction
58e380e8470e54d31e9d494c5d560def13f4918f8b1d69a18f85ef29469d773b
spent
true